Quasars are exceptionally brilliant objects that are typically discovered inhabiting the historic and really remote Universe. These extraordinarily distant bodies are usually believed to possess initially caught fire a “mere” few hundred million years immediately after the inflationary Major Bang birth of the World practically 14 billion dollars years ago. Quasars dazzle the Ensemble with their brutal, brilliant fires–they are truly the accretion disks encircling younger, voracious, and money grabbing supermassive black slots lurking in the hearts of child galaxies that were forming inside the incredibly early Universe. Supermassive black holes stay with the dark hearts and minds of pretty much all–if not all– substantial galaxies, and they also weigh-in at millions to be able to billions of occasions more than the Star, the Sunlight. Our own large, barred-spiral Galaxy, typically the Milky Way, holds a supermassive dark hole in its secretive heart. That is called Sagittarius A* (Sgr A*, for brief ), and it will be relatively light-weight, simply by supermassive black pit standards, weighing basically millions–as against billions–of times much more as compared to our Star.

The Normal Cosmological Model regarding structure formation throughout the Universe forecasts that galaxies will be embedded within the filaments of the fantastic Cosmic Web, almost all of which (about 84%) is composed associated with the mysterious, translucent, ghostly dark subject. This Cosmic spider’s web is observed in laptop or computer simulations that make an effort to model the evolution of composition in the Galaxy. The simulations present the evolution involving the dark matter on substantial machines, including the darkness matter halos in which galaxies are created and the Cosmic Internet composed associated with dark matter filaments that connect these people.
The force of gravity causes “ordinary” atomic matter in order to stick to the circulation of the dark matter. In this particular way, filaments regarding diffuse ionized fuel are believed to be able to outline a spidery pattern like the particular 1 observed in dark matter personal computer simulations.

New Light In The Cosmic Net
Until now, the particular filaments of deep matter that place the magnificent Cosmic Net have by no means been straight seen. Even though the petrol that floats around in intergalactic place has currently recently been spotted, because of absorption of light gushing from brilliant qualifications sources, these findings do not present how the gas is distributed. In typically the January 2014 research, on the other hand, the researchers spotted the neon glow of hydrogen gas as a result of the illumination from the effective radiation emanating through the quasar.
“This quasar is illuminating diffuse gas on scales nicely over and above any we’ve noticed prior to, providing us all the first image of extended gas in between galaxies. It provides an excellent regarding the all round structure of our own Universe, ” observed study co-author Dr. Prochaska inside a January 19, 2014 UC Santa Cruz Press Release.
The hydrogen gas, that is lit up simply by the quasar, sends forth ultraviolet mild referred to as the Lyman alpha radiation. Typically the illuminating quasar alone is really remote–about ten billion light-years away. Indeed, the quasar’s emitted light is “stretched” simply by the expansion in the Universe to the point that it is original invisible ultraviolet (uv) wavelength has turn into a visible shade of violet to the prying “eyes” associated with Keck. By figuring out the distance to the quasar, the particular astronomers had been in a position to establish the particular wavelength with the lyman alpha radiation by that distance, and constructed a specific filtering for the ‘scope’s LRIS spectrometer in order to acquire an photo at that wavelength.
